12V photovoltaic panel output voltage
While denoted as 12 volts, these panels typically function at a higher output voltage level, generally between 17 to 22 volts in peak sunlight. The variance in voltage output arises from several factors, including panel type, environmental conditions, and the inherent properties of solar cells. [pdf]

How do I determine the power consumption of my inverter?
Determine the power consumption (in watts) for each of the appliances you plan to simultaneously power with the inverter's AC output. To find this value, check for tags on the appliance's plug or adapter box. If you cannot find it there, try checking the "Technical Specifications" section in the owner's manual.
How do I calculate the power rating of my inverter?
To calculate the published power rating you need, you must determine the total load for the AC circuit (i.e., the plug-in appliance) and then divide it by the inverter's efficiency. How do you calculate inverter efficiency?
Inverter Efficiency is the efficiency rating of the inverter, expressed as a decimal. It represents the percentage of input power that is converted to usable output power. To calculate the inverter size, multiply the total wattage by the safety factor, and then divide the result by the inverter efficiency. What is an Inverter Size?
How do you calculate the minimum safe output of an inverter?
Add together all of the power ratings from step 1. This represents the total output power required. Multiply the total power required by 1.25. Doing so is designed to create a buffer that will protect the inverter against power surges. Call this new value the "minimum safe output." Round the result from step 3 up to the nearest 100.
